Title XVIII LABOR AND INDUSTRIAL RELATIONS Chapter 287 Effective - 28 Aug 2005 287.550. Proceedings before commission to be informal and summary. — All proceedings before the commission or any commissioner shall be simple, informal, and summary, and without regard to the technical rules of evidence, and in accordance with section 287.800. All such proceedings shall be according to such rules and regulations as may be adopted by the commission. ­­-------- (RSMo 1939 § 3739, A.L. 2005 S.B. 1 & 130) Prior revision: 1929 § 3349 (1959) Where application for appeal from the referee specified the various findings and contended that they were unsupported by evidence, the application for appeal to the commission was sufficient notwithstanding the sole question related to the extent and nature of the disability of the employee. Collins v. Eichler Heating Co. (A.), 319 S.W.2d 666.
